Iran forbids its sports teams from traveling to ‘hostile’ countries

Iran has recently made headlines with its decision to ban its sports teams from traveling to countries it considers “hostile.” This move has sparked controversy and raised questions about the country’s stance on international relations and sportsmanship.

According to Iranian state TV, the ban was put in place ahead of Tractor FC’s scheduled soccer game in Saudi Arabia. The team was set to play against Al-Ahli in the Asian Football Confederation (AFC) Champions League, but the ban has now prevented them from doing so.

This decision has been met with mixed reactions, with some praising Iran for taking a stand against countries it deems as hostile, while others criticize the move as being politically motivated and detrimental to the country’s sports industry.

Iran’s Ministry of Sports and Youth Affairs has stated that the ban is a precautionary measure to protect the safety and well-being of its athletes. The ministry has also emphasized that this decision is not limited to just Saudi Arabia, but also includes other countries that are deemed hostile by Iran.

This is not the first time Iran has implemented such a ban. In 2018, the country banned its athletes from competing against Israeli opponents in any sport. This decision was made in support of the Palestinian cause and to protest against Israel’s occupation of Palestinian territories.
